The largest share of delay minutes, 76%, falls under carrier control: crew scheduling, maintenance, fuelling, baggage. Unlike weather, that is a management outcome, and it is the category where the gap between two carriers on the same schedule is genuinely earned. It accounts for 4,164 of the 5,496 delay minutes reported here. The split is drawn from 5,496 delay minutes reported on OH 5193.

Cancellations run at 5.23%, against 1.81% nationally. That is about one flight in twenty cancelled outright. A cancelled flight is invisible in every on-time figure on this page, so the punctuality numbers above describe only the flights that actually operated.

7.0% of arrivals land an hour or more late, close to the national 8.1%. That is the figure that decides a connection, and it says a 60 to 75 minute layover is reasonable here while anything under 45 minutes is a bet. Most delays on this route last about 2.4 hours, which a normal layover absorbs.

The 607 miles between these two airports put this in the middle of the US network, around two and a half to three hours of block time. That is enough cruise to absorb a ten-minute late pushback and not enough to absorb thirty. It is also long enough that the aircraft usually flies three or four legs a day rather than six, which slows how fast delay compounds.
